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Software Engineer (Staff level and up), Linux Device Drivers

Full-time

Qualcomm

Experience with Linux kernel driver development, kernel modules, sysfs and debugging techniques Experience with development in C Experience with git Willingness to work in a structured software development environment Ability to work on low-level implementation (code & test) 4+ years of relevant experience Experience with Linux kernel PCIe stack DKMS-based management of kernel modules DEB or RPM packaging TCP/IP understanding (MTU, IP addressing, DHCP, kernel networking/netdev) Strong understanding of DMA, IOMMU Experience with 'SoC-as-a-Device' architectures or embedded Linux systems connected via PCIe. Bachelor's degree in Engineering, Information Systems, Computer Science, or related field and 4+ years of Software Engineering or related work experience. OR Master's degree in Engineering, Information Systems, Computer Science, or related field and 3+ years of Software Engineering or related work experience. OR PhD in Engineering, Information Systems, Computer Science, or related field and 2+ years of Software Engineering or related work experience. 2+ years of work experience with Programming Language such as C, C++, Java, Python, etc.

Vacancy posted more than 2 months 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Software Engineer (Staff level and up), Linux Device Drivers. Be the first to apply!